一、引言
随着人工智能技术的飞速发展,其在图像处理和计算机视觉等领域的应用日益广泛。
绘制细致网状图案是许多行业中的重要环节,如纺织、建筑、艺术等。
本文将介绍如何利用人工智能技术实现这一任务,帮助读者快速掌握相关技能。
本文内容实用,适用于初学者和专业人士,旨在提供从理论到实践的全面指导。
二、准备阶段
在利用人工智能技术绘制细致网状图案之前,我们需要做好以下准备工作:
1. 选择合适的开发工具:根据需求,选择一款集成人工智能算法的开发工具或编程环境,如Python的TensorFlow、PyTorch等深度学习框架。
2. 收集数据:准备训练模型所需的数据集,包括各种网状图案的图片。数据集应涵盖多种样式、颜色和尺寸,以提高模型的泛化能力。
3. 基础知识储备:了解深度学习、卷积神经网络(CNN)等基础知识,为后续的模型训练打下基础。
三、利用人工智能技术绘制细致网状图案的步骤
1. 数据预处理:对收集到的网状图案图片进行预处理,包括调整尺寸、归一化、数据增强等操作,以提高模型的训练效果。
2. 模型选择:根据任务需求选择合适的神经网络模型,如卷积神经网络(CNN)。若需生成更复杂的图案,可考虑使用生成对抗网络(GAN)等技术。
3. 模型训练:利用预处理后的数据训练模型。在训练过程中,不断调整模型参数以优化性能。
4. 模型评估:通过测试集评估模型的性能,确保模型能够生成满足需求的网状图案。
5. 图案生成:利用训练好的模型生成网状图案。可以通过调整模型输入参数,得到不同风格的图案。
四、实战操作指南
1. 安装所需软件:安装Python编程环境和所选深度学习框架,如TensorFlow或PyTorch。
2. 收集和预处理数据:从网络、自有数据库或专业资源中收集网状图案图片,进行尺寸调整、归一化和数据增强等预处理操作。
3. 构建和训练模型:根据需求选择合适的神经网络模型,如CNN或GAN。利用预处理后的数据训练模型,并调整参数优化性能。
4. 模型应用与评估:利用训练好的模型生成网状图案,通过测试集评估模型的性能。
5. 调试和优化:根据生成结果和评估指标,对模型进行调试和优化,以获得更好的性能。
6. 创意拓展:尝试将模型应用于其他领域,如纹理合成、图像风格转换等,以拓展技能和应用范围。
五、常见问题及解决方案
1. 模型训练不稳定:可能由于数据集不足或模型结构不合理导致。解决方案包括增加数据集、调整模型结构和优化超参数。
2. 生成图案质量不高:可能由于模型性能不足或训练不充分导致。可以尝试使用更复杂的模型、增加训练轮次和改变训练策略来提高生成质量。
3. 模型泛化能力不强:若模型在测试集上表现不佳,可能缺乏足够的泛化能力。可以通过增加数据多样性、使用正则化技术等方法提高模型的泛化能力。
六、结论
本文介绍了利用人工智能技术绘制细致网状图案的实战指南,包括准备阶段、步骤、实战操作指南和常见问题及解决方案。
通过本文的学习,读者可以快速掌握利用人工智能技术绘制细致网状图案的技能,为相关领域的应用提供有力支持。
随着人工智能技术的不断发展,相信其在图像处理和计算机视觉等领域的应用将越来越广泛,为我们的生活带来更多便利和创意。
发表评论